Background
Hello!Lucky is a design and letterpress studio founded by sisters Eunice and Sabrina Moyle and based in San Francisco’s historic Dogpatch district. They create stylish, vintage-inspired, letterpress wedding invitations, custom birth announcements, and greeting cards.
Letterpress is a centuries-old artisanal printing technique that uses plates that press into paper with a single color of ink at a time—resulting in crisp, saturated colors and a distinctively dimensional look and feel.
Hello!Lucky’s designers work the territory from formal to funky—creating unique wedding invitations to match each couple’s particular wedding style: floral, modern, cheery, graceful, or hip.
Hello!Lucky cards are sold in shops worldwide, including Anthropologie, Kate’s Paperie, and Liberty of London. You may have seen their designs featured on The Today Show or in Daily Candy, and in such magazines as InStyle, Lucky, Jane, Real Simple, Marie Claire, InStyle Weddings and Martha Stewart Weddings.
Eunice and Sabrina partnered with Chronicle Books to create the Hello Baby! line of a baby journal, photo album, and greeting cards. Their card-crafting book, Handmade Hellos is also published by Chronicle.
Services
Hello!Lucky crafts one-of-a-kind letterpress wedding invitations, save-the-date cards, accommodations cards, wedding programs, seating cards, thank-you cards, and personalized stationery.
In addition to their fully customized letterpress work, their affordable Marry Me! line of letterpress wedding invitations offers select designs, streamlined options, and turnaround in a jiffy.
Extras: Hello!Lucky works with several established calligraphers. Their website offers plenty of useful etiquette advice—for example, how to handle some of the sticky situations in wording wedding invitations.
